In this casual Chats with Shana episode, I’m taking you along on our sweaty summer trip to Charleston, South Carolina. 🌴 You’ll hear about: Milo’s first vacation (spoiler: he’s a sand-digging pro) Dining outside in 95° heat… while swatting a swarm of flies Why Folly Beach is a top spot for shark attacks—and why we still went A surprise encounter with a horseshoe crab under the pier The iconic rowboat scene from The Notebook—yep, we went! Tasting frog legs and learning about frog gigging The Southern tradition of painting porch ceilings "haint blue" to keep away spirits Plus, fun facts about pineapples, sweet tea, ghost tours, and more! You'll also learn natural expressions like “sweating bullets,” “the cherry on top,” “food for thought,” and “to keep something at bay,” all explained as we go.
